Code Signing certificaat: wat is het en waarom heb je het nodig?
Code Signing Certificates eenvoudig uitgelegd
Het internet zit vol complexiteit als het gaat om werking en connectiviteit. De meeste mensen surfen zonder te weten welke stappen nodig zijn om hun ervaring veilig te houden. Voor professionals in de IT- en softwarewereld is het echter essentieel om deze processen goed te begrijpen.
In dit artikel leggen we uit wat code signing certificaten zijn, hoe ze werken en waarom ze belangrijk zijn.
Wat zijn Code Signing certificaten?
Een Code Signing certificaat is te vergelijken met een digitale identiteitskaart voor softwareontwikkelaars. Het bevestigt dat software of een applicatie afkomstig is van een betrouwbare bron. Dit helpt gebruikers om met vertrouwen software te downloaden en te installeren.
Waarom zijn Code Signing certificaten belangrijk?
Vertrouwen opbouwen
Gebruikers zien dat je software geverifieerd is, wat vertrouwen geeft en beveiligingswaarschuwingen vermindert.
Bescherming van je code
Een code signing certificaat zorgt ervoor dat niemand je code kan aanpassen en zich kan voordoen als de originele ontwikkelaar.
Bescherming tegen malware
Het helpt gebruikers te bevestigen dat software veilig is en niet is gemanipuleerd.
Betere downloads
Platformen zoals Windows en macOS vertrouwen ondertekende software meer, wat resulteert in minder waarschuwingen en hogere installatieratio’s.
Waar worden Code Signing certificaten voor gebruikt?
Verifiëren van software
Toont aan gebruikers dat de software daadwerkelijk van jou afkomstig is en niet is aangepast.
Ondertekenen van applicaties en updates
Ontwikkelaars gebruiken deze certificaten om apps, software, drivers en updates te beveiligen.
Voorkomen van waarschuwingen
Zonder code signing certificaat krijgen gebruikers vaak meldingen dat software mogelijk onveilig is.
Hoe krijg je een Code Signing certificaat?
1. Kies een betrouwbare provider
Selecteer een Certificate Authority (CA) zoals DigiCert, Sectigo of GlobalSign.
2. Kies het juiste type certificaat
Er zijn certificaten voor individuele ontwikkelaars en voor organisaties.
3. Verifieer je identiteit
De CA vraagt om documentatie om je identiteit of bedrijf te bevestigen.
4. Koop en installeer het certificaat
Na goedkeuring ontvang je het certificaat. Gebruik tools zoals Microsoft SignTool om je code te ondertekenen.
5. Bewaar het certificaat veilig
Zorg ervoor dat je certificaat goed beveiligd is om misbruik te voorkomen.
Conclusie
Een Code Signing certificaat is een belangrijk vertrouwensbewijs voor je software. Het beschermt je code, verhoogt de veiligheid voor gebruikers en zorgt voor een betere gebruikerservaring bij installatie.
Voor ontwikkelaars is het een essentiële stap om te laten zien dat hun software veilig en betrouwbaar is.
0 reacties